Key Factors to Consider When Buying Jewelry

1. Material Matters

  • Precious Metals: Gold, platinum, and sterling silver are durable and resistant to corrosion.
  • Alloys: Ensure gold pieces are correctly marked (e.g., 14K or 18K) to verify purity.
  • Plating: Gold-plated or silver-plated items are more affordable but may wear over time.
  • Durability: Consider daily wear when choosing materials—harder metals like platinum are ideal for frequently worn pieces.

2. Gemstone Quality

  • Cut: Determines brilliance and sparkle. Well-cut stones reflect light evenly.
  • Color: For colored gemstones, rich, even hues indicate quality.
  • Clarity: Fewer inclusions or flaws enhance beauty and value.
  • Carat/Size: Consider proportion to the piece and personal preference.
  • Certification: For diamonds or precious stones, check for grading reports from recognized labs (GIA, IGI, or AGS).

3. Craftsmanship

  • Look for smooth finishes, secure settings, and symmetry.
  • Check clasps, prongs, and links to ensure durability.
  • Handcrafted or designer pieces often show attention to detail.

Tips for Buying Jewelry Safely Online and In-Store

  • Verify Authenticity: Ask for certificates for precious stones and metals.
  • Check Return Policies: Ensure flexibility if the piece doesn’t meet expectations.
  • Compare Prices: Research market value to avoid overpaying.
  • Inspect Pieces: For in-store purchases, look closely at materials, gemstones, and finishing.
  • Ask About Maintenance: Some metals and stones require regular cleaning or special care.

Jewelry Care for Longevity

Proper care keeps jewelry looking its best:

  • Store pieces separately in soft pouches or lined boxes to prevent scratches.
  • Clean regularly using recommended methods for each material.
  • Remove jewelry before swimming, showering, or heavy exercise.
  • Schedule professional cleaning and inspections for valuable pieces periodically.
